Homa Bay MCA’s home in Rongo town raided

By MN Reporter

Violent politics in Homa Bay spilled over in Migori after an MCA from neighbouring county had his house raided by hooligans believed to have been hired by a prominent politician in Homa Bay.

South Kabuoch MCA Oscar Ouma Dibuoro’s residential house in Rongo Town was raided this weekend and his personal belongings carried away.

Dibuoro was away in Kisumu for official duty when his house was attacked in what the MCA said was caused by political differences.

Addressing the press in Rongo town After recording statement with the police the MCA expressed fear over his life and appealed for more security.

“I am not safe as the hooligans left a word that they would come back for me. They said I must die before the end of the year,” he said.

An eye witness Calvins Nyamanga said that hooligans were chanting that they do not want Dibuoro and they wanted to kill him.

“It is unfortunate for incident of that kind to occur few kilometers away from the Rongo Police station. It showed police laxity,” Nyamanga said.

He said relatives were woken up by a loud bang as hooligans struggled to gain entry but it was too late to raise alarm as the main steel door of the house had already been broken.

Armed with crude weapons, they attacked and harassed relative who were taken to Rongo District Hospital.

Confirming the incident, Rongo OCPD Thomas Ngeiywa condemned the incident and promised to carry out through investigations  with a view of apprehending perpetrators of such hooliganism.
